Many production processes in the food industry cause a waste air composite made ofsmoke and impurities resulting in odour. The six energy-saving modules of the AAIRMAXX®air filtration system provide a solution to any problem created by waste air in the food processing industry.

Activated Lignite FilterActivated Carbon and Lignite are oftenconsidered to be a universal remedy forthe removal of odour at food processingfactories. Odorous substances and airmolecules settle on the surface of theActivated Lignite. For a cost-effectiveoperation it is necessary to have an effective pre-treatment of waste air as well as the right dimensioning welladapted to each case of operation. Therefore the range of application islarge.

BiofiltrationThe Biofilter from the AAIRMAXX®

modular system is designed to removeodour and gas of a low concentrationfrom large volumes of waste air. Theoperation of a Biofilter is particularlycost-effective in the case of constantwaste air flow.

Air Cooling, Heat RecoveryIn the case of cleaning waste air of ahigh temperature (> 40° C) and high humidity the AAIRMAXX® air cooler can be used in the conditioning stage, in particular for Biofilters and Activated Lignite filters. Waste air vertically passesthrough a heat exchanger made ofstainless steel tubes. Separated oil,grease, and water are then dischargedby a condensate drain. Heat recovery in the form of hot processing water can be achieved in combination with a KMA Ambitherm heat pump.

Electrostatic precipitators for the separation of smokeand dustThe AAIRMAXX® particle filter effecti-vely separates aerosols such as grease,tar (smoke), or oil from waste air with-out clogging. It is made of one or seve-ral metal tubes with an ionisator in themiddle of each tube. The particles arecharged by electrostatic energy andsettle on the inner surface of the tubes.The cleaning process of the filter takesplace automatically and at regular intervals.

Waste Air ScrubberThe scrubber is designed for the sepa-ration of odour, gas, and fumes, andoperates according to the absorptionprinciple. The gases and fumes contai-ned in the waste air are first capturedand then separated by the use of anappropriate washing liquid. Further-more the scrubber can be applied as a humidifier before waste air entersinto the biological filter.

UV Light OxidationMalodorous VOC molecules (e. g. from frying processes or large-scale kitchens) can be oxidised by means of UV light. The result is a considerablereduction in odour, and in many casesodour eliminated altogether.

Tunnel Frying Units

Ham Smokehouse

This smokehouse facility with more than 20 smokingchambers was equipped with a central KMA AAIR-MAXX® filter system which consisted of an electro-static filter for the removal of smoke and tar as wellas a waste air scrubber. The filter has a modular design and is cleaned by an integrated automatic CIP cleaning system.

Protecting the environment:saving energy as well as costs.No problem with a KMA wasteair filtration system

Two KMA AAIRMAXX® filter systems were installed topurify the waste air (grease, smoke, odour) of severaltunnel frying units with an overall waste air volumeof 12 000 m³/h. The filter system consists of air-to-airheat exchangers, scrubbers, and biofilters. The systemwas mounted on the rooftop, directly above fryingunits.

Production facility for fish food

Fish food production processes cause highly malodorous waste air. In order to avoid annoyanceto neighbouring residences waste air is being purified by an AAIRMAXX® air filtration system.The filter system consists of a waste air scrubberand an activated lignite filter. The pH level con-trol and the water exchange take place auto-matically. The activated lignite filter is composedof two separate towers providing a capacity of 12 500 m³/h each.

Hot Dog production line

The production process of hot dogs on a smoking and scalding continuous line creates a large load ofsmoke and odour. Initially a thermal post-combustionsystem was used for this application, however due to high operating costs and enormous CO2 emissionsthis system was replaced by a KMA AAIRMAXX®

smoke filtration system, providing a capacity of 1 500 m³/h. The annual energy cost savings thereforeadd up to more than 60 000 Euro; leading to the annual reduction of greenhouse gas emissions bymore then 200 t!

In the food processing industry the largest potentialto avoid CO2 emissions, apart from refrigeration tech-nology, lies within waste air filtration technology.Conventional catalytic or thermal post-combustionsystems require large amounts of oil, gas, or electri-city for waste air purification. High energy consump-tion is therefore accompanied by a correspondingamount of CO2 emissions.

For example: a thermal post-combustion systems providing a capacity of 1 500 m³/h (corresponding approximately to a smokehouse with 6-8 smokingchambers) requires more than 50 m³ of natural gas,even when used in combination with a modern heatrecovery system. This is not only costly, but leads toCO2 emissions equating to approximately 100 kgevery hour. The consequence: even if the annual use is only 1 500 hours (equivalent to approximately 6 hours of smoking per day) an operator will face

an energy consumption of more than 50 000 m³ ofnatural gas. While simultaneously generating a CO2

burden of approximately 100 tons! This is where anenormous potential for cost and CO2 savings lies formany smoke houses and frying facilities:

By replacing an old air treatment device with anenergy-saving AAIRMAXX® filter system energy consumption is decreased by around 80 percent. This is accompanied by a considerable reduction of CO2

emissions. In the example mentioned above, the re-sult is an annual reduction of CO2 emissions by over80 tonnes! The expenditure for a new filter systemwill therefore be amortised in less than 3 years.
